A security source announced the arrest of one of those involved in the 'theft of the century' in Diyala Governorate. The source told the correspondent of the National Iraqi News Agency / NINA / that 'a joint security force arrested one of those involved in the theft of 9 billion dinars from the financial allocations for compensation in a specific operation that took place in Baquba late yesterday evening, following the issuance of an arrest warrant from the concerned judicial authority based on an urgent request from the Governor of Diyala Agency.' The source added that ' money inside locked iron safes, large sums of money packed in plastic bags and travel bags, as well as antiquities were found in his possession.' He pointed out: 'The detainee is an employee in the Diyala Governorate Office, and the security forces are tracking the movement of his partners. Source: National Iraqi News Agency
